The cheapest way to get from Esch-sur-Alzette to Basel is to bus via Basel Euroairport FR which costs SFr 29 - SFr 50 and takes 6h 41m.
The fastest way to get from Esch-sur-Alzette to Basel is to drive which takes 3h 26m and costs SFr 50 - SFr 80.
No, there is no direct bus from Esch-sur-Alzette to Basel. However, there are services departing from Esch-sur-Alzette, Gare routière and arriving at Basel, Meret Oppenheim-Strasse (Bahnhof SBB) via Luxembourg, Gare Centrale routière and Luxembourg.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 6h 36m.
The distance between Esch-sur-Alzette and Basel is 349 km. The road distance is 320.2 km.
The best way to get from Esch-sur-Alzette to Basel without a car is to line 551 bus and train which takes 4h 56m and costs SFr 55 - SFr 100.
It takes approximately 4h 56m to get from Esch-sur-Alzette to Basel, including transfers.
Esch-sur-Alzette to Basel bus services, operated by BlaBlaCar Bus, depart from Luxembourg station.
The best way to get from Esch-sur-Alzette to Basel is to bus which takes 6h 36m and costs SFr 27 - SFr 50. Alternatively, you can fly, which costs SFr 100 - SFr 310 and takes 6h 3m.
Esch-sur-Alzette to Basel bus services, operated by BlaBlaCar Bus, arrive at Basel, Meret Oppenheim-Strasse (Bahnhof SBB) station.
Yes, the driving distance between Esch-sur-Alzette to Basel is 320 km. It takes approximately 3h 26m to drive from Esch-sur-Alzette to Basel.
What companies run services between Esch-sur-Alzette, Luxembourg and Basel, Switzerland?
BlaBlaCar Bus operates a bus from Luxembourg to Basel, Meret Oppenheim-Strasse (Bahnhof SBB) twice daily. Tickets cost CHF 27–50 and the journey takes 4h 40m. Alternatively, Lufthansa, KLM, and three other airlines fly from Luxembourg (LUX) to Basel (BSL) every 4 hours.
